When ionic bonds are put in water, the ions in the compound dissociate due to the polar nature of water molecules. The positive ions are attracted to the oxygen atoms of water, while the negative ions are attracted to the hydrogen atoms. This results in the formation of hydrated ions and the compound dissolving in water.
